SQL C#/SQL开发人员的顶级工具

SQL C#/SQL开发人员的顶级工具

在本文中,我们将介绍一些对于C#/SQL开发人员来说非常有用的顶级工具。这些工具可以帮助开发人员提高工作效率,简化开发过程,并提供更好的错误诊断和调试功能。

阅读更多:SQL 教程

SQL Server Management Studio (SSMS)

SQL Server Management Studio(SSMS)是一款由微软开发的免费工具,用于管理和开发Microsoft SQL Server。它提供了一个直观的界面,可以方便地交互式地创建、修改和执行SQL查询。除了基本的查询功能之外,SSMS还提供了丰富的编辑器、调试器和报告工具,以及用于配置服务器选项和监视性能的功能。

以下是SSMS的一个示例:

SELECT * FROM Customers WHERE Country = 'China'
SQL

这个查询将返回所有来自中国的客户的信息。

MySQL Workbench

MySQL Workbench是一款由MySQL开发的免费工具,用于管理和开发MySQL数据库。它提供了一种直观的界面,允许开发人员创建、修改和执行SQL查询。MySQL Workbench还提供了数据库建模和设计工具,可以帮助开发人员创建和维护数据库架构。

以下是MySQL Workbench的一个示例:

SELECT * FROM Customers WHERE Country = 'China'
SQL

这个查询将返回所有来自中国的客户的信息。

Visual Studio

Visual Studio是一款由微软开发的集成开发环境(IDE),用于开发各种类型的应用程序,包括C#和SQL。Visual Studio提供了强大的编辑器、调试器和集成的工具,可大大简化开发过程并提高生产力。它还具有许多扩展和插件,可以根据开发人员的需要进行定制。

以下是Visual Studio中的一个示例:

string connectionString = "Data Source=myServerAddress;Initial Catalog=myDataBase;User Id=myUsername;Password=myPassword;";
SqlConnection connection = new SqlConnection(connectionString);
SqlCommand command = new SqlCommand("SELECT * FROM Customers WHERE Country = 'China'", connection);
connection.Open();
SqlDataReader reader = command.ExecuteReader();
while (reader.Read())
{
    Console.WriteLine(reader["CustomerName"]);
}
connection.Close();
C#

这个示例演示了如何使用C#语言连接到数据库,并使用SQL查询从数据库中检索数据。

Navicat

Navicat是一款功能强大的数据库管理工具,支持多种数据库系统,包括MySQL、SQL Server、Oracle等。这个工具提供了一个直观的界面,允许开发人员管理、编辑和执行SQL查询。Navicat还提供了广泛的数据导入和导出功能,可以方便地将数据从一个数据库迁移到另一个数据库。

以下是Navicat的一个示例:

SELECT * FROM Customers WHERE Country = 'China'
SQL

这个查询将返回所有来自中国的客户的信息。

SQL Prompt

SQL Prompt是一款由Redgate开发的SQL开发工具,用于提高开发人员的生产力并保持一致的SQL编码风格。SQL Prompt提供了智能代码完成、格式化、重构和代码分析功能,可以帮助开发人员编写高质量的SQL代码。此外,它还具有自定义代码片段和模板的功能,方便开发人员重复使用常见的SQL语句。

以下是SQL Prompt的一个示例:

SELECT *
FROM Customers
WHERE Country = 'China'
SQL

这个查询使用SQL Prompt自动格式化和完善了SQL代码。

总结

以上所介绍的SQL顶级工具对于C#/SQL开发人员来说非常有用。它们提供了丰富的功能和工具,可以简化开发过程并提高生产力。无论是管理和开发数据库,还是编写高质量的SQL代码,这些工具都能为开发人员提供良好的支持和帮助。无论你是初学者还是有经验的开发人员,这些工具都可以在你的开发工作中发挥重要的作用。

Python教程

Java教程

Web教程

数据库教程

图形图像教程

大数据教程

开发工具教程

计算机教程

登录

注册